Mylyn is a girl's name of American origin. A feminine modern creation blending My- with -lyn, one of the most productive name-building suffixes in contemporary American naming. Mylyn feels soft and poetic while remaining current, appealing to parents who want a name that is distinctive but still recognizable in structure. The -lyn ending carries associations with grace and femininity.
Part of the pervasive -lyn suffix trend that dominated American baby naming from the 1980s onward.
